Lithium-ion battery testing and certification services primarily include testing and certification services for lithium-ion batteries.
Testing typically refers to determining whether a product possesses certain characteristics at the prototype stage, including performance, reliability, lifespan, and composition, such as the heavy metal content of a food product. Product certification or qualification is the process of proving that a product has passed performance and quality assurance testing and meets the qualification standards stipulated in contracts, regulations, or specifications. Most product certification bodies are certified or comply with ISO/IEC 17065 Conformity Assessment – Requirements for Certification Bodies of Products, Processes and Services, an international standard designed to ensure the competence of organizations performing product, process and service certifications. With the increasing use of lithium-ion batteries in products, finished product manufacturers and consumers expect reliable assurances regarding battery performance, reliability, and safety.
Lithium-ion battery testing and certification services are third-party testing and certification services focused on battery safety, performance, and compliance. These services cover mechanical testing (explosion, needle penetration), environmental testing (high and low temperatures, salt spray), electrical testing (overcharge, short circuit), and electrical performance testing (capacity, cycle life), ensuring batteries meet international standards (such as IEC 62133, UL 2054), domestic mandatory standards (such as GB 31241), and target market certifications (such as CE, PSE). Market drivers primarily include:
Technological iteration and performance upgrade demands: Lithium-ion battery energy density is breaking through to 400Wh/kg, and charging speeds are increasing to 6C rates. Traditional testing equipment can no longer meet the high-precision requirements. Leading companies are shortening testing cycles by 30% through integrated "cell-system" testing solutions, driving up industry gross margins. For example, CATL uses an AI-driven testing system to quantitatively assess battery pack thermal runaway risk, reducing after-sales failure rates by 50%.
Policy Mandate and Standard Upgrades: Global carbon neutrality goals are accelerating the penetration of new energy vehicles. China's target of 25% new energy vehicle sales by 2025 is forcing battery companies to adopt high-safety testing standards. Meanwhile, the EU's Battery Regulation requires a 70% battery recycling rate by 2030, and testing equipment must support full lifecycle data traceability, driving the industry towards intelligent and green transformation.
Expanded Application Scenarios and Supply Chain Collaboration: Lithium-ion battery applications are expanding from new energy vehicles to low-altitude economies (such as electric aircraft) and energy storage systems (such as the Zhejiang in-situ solid-state energy storage power station), placing higher demands on battery cycle life (>8000 cycles) and charge/discharge efficiency (>95%). The upstream and downstream of the supply chain are accelerating technology implementation and market penetration through joint R&D (such as sharing testing process databases) and standardization (such as the CTC interface specification). For example, BYD collaborated with NIO to develop a semi-solid-state battery testing system that supports both ultra-fast charging and long battery life requirements.
